In an era marked by burgeoning social reform and a growing awareness of animal rights, "The Golden Age Cook Book" by Henrietta Latham Dwight emerges as a beacon for the vegetarian movement. This late 19th-century cookbook not only offers a diverse array of plant-based recipes but also champions the principles of compassion and ethical eating. With its emphasis on a bloodless diet and the promotion of vegetarianism, this document serves as both a culinary guide and a manifesto for those seeking to align their dietary choices with their values. Ideal for students, civic activists, and historians alike, this book invites readers to explore the intersection of food, ethics, and lifestyle in a transformative period of history.
